What do the colors of the power cord mean?

People who often deal with power cords know that power cords are different in color. Common colors include yellow, red, green, blue, and so on. Although many people also know that power cords are divided into colors, they do not know why they are divided into colors and what each color represents. Then the editor below will explain the meanings of common power cord colors.


  Yellow: +12V


   Yellow is currently the most distributed power cord among all electrical appliances. It represents +12V, which is the most common current value. If the yellow power cord cannot be energized normally, it will damage the corresponding power cord and affect the normal use of the electrical appliance.


  Blue: -12V


   The blue power cord corresponds to the yellow, it represents a negative 12 volt power supply. Generally, there are very few blue power cords in various electrical appliances, but once they exist, they cannot be removed, otherwise it will affect the normal operation of the machine and cause various losses.


  Red: +5V


   The number of red power cords is similar to that of yellow power cords. It is one of the most important power cords in electrical appliances. It represents a positive 5 volt power supply. Generally, the power supply is the working voltage of each integrated circuit. As long as there is an integrated circuit in the electrical appliance, there will be a red power line near the integrated circuit.


  White: -5V


  The white power cord is relatively seldom used. It is the opposite of red, which means -5V. Generally, the white power line provides the judgment level for the logic circuit. The amount of current it passes through is very small and will not easily affect the normal operation of the system. It is basically optional.


   In addition to these four colors, the power cord has other colors, such as green and purple. As long as you understand the meaning of power cord colors in detail, you can know their various functions in electrical appliances.
